简体   繁体   English

从每月或每周或每天或议程更改视图会使应用程序对大日历做出反应

[英]Changing view from month to week or day or agenda crashes the app react big calendar

Bug: Changing view from month to week or day or agenda crashes the app.错误:从每月或每周或每天或议程更改视图会使应用程序崩溃。 I suspect it is something to do with moment.我怀疑这与时刻有关。

My code我的代码

import { Calendar, momentLocalizer } from "react-big-calendar";
import moment from "moment";
import "react-big-calendar/lib/css/react-big-calendar.css";

const localizer = momentLocalizer(moment);

const Calendars = () => {
 
  return (
    <div>
<Calendar events={events} startAccessor="start_date" endAccessor="end_date" defaultDate={ new Date()} localizer={localizer} />
    </div>
  );
};

Sample data样本数据

This is the data I am passing to calendar function这是我传递给日历function 的数据

cost events = [
 {
  "title": "Work",
   "start_date": "2020-02-10T09:00:00.000Z",
   "end_date": "2020-02-10T11:00:00.000Z"
 },
 {
  "title": "Work",
  "start_date": "2020-02-08T09:00:00.000Z",
   "end_date": "2020-02-08T11:00:00.000Z"
 }
]

What could I be doing wrong?我可能做错了什么?

you should convert "start_date" and "end_date" to js date object => moment(start_date).toDate()您应该将“start_date”和“end_date”转换为 js 日期 object => moment(start_date).toDate()

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M